Responsibilities

  • Lead solicitation and RFP review/analysis, proposal preparation, and signoff.
  • Examine estimates of material, equipment services, production costs, performance requirements, and delivery schedules to ensure accuracy and completeness.
  • Negotiate, administer, extend and close standard and nonstandard contracts.
  • Provide for proper contract acquisition and fulfillment in accordance with company policies, legal requirements, and customer specifications.
  • Establish successful working relationships with customers via email, telephone and in-person when appropriate.
  • Collaborate effectively with the program team (finance, supply chain, quality & mission assurance, legal, pricing, and compliance) to recommend and complete actions to ensure satisfactory program performance.
  • Work with program business management team to closely monitor contract funding and payments.
  • Advise management of contractual rights and obligations.
  • Compile and analyze data.
  • Maintain historical information including official correspondence.
  • Enter and maintain contract data into Contract Management System and /or Enterprise Resource Planning System.
  • Ensure timely delivery of all contractual deliverables and submission of invoices.
  • Analyze and negotiate non-disclosure agreements, teaming agreements, software licensing agreements, and other memoranda.
